Since 1996, the Adani Foundation, the social welfare and development arm of the Adani Group, has been at the forefront of driving positive change through strategic and sustainable social initiatives across India.
With a strong focus on education, health and nutrition, sustainable livelihoods, climate action, and community development, the Foundation empowers children, women, youth, and marginalised communities. Its approach is closely aligned with national priorities and the global Sustainable Development Goals. Currently, the Foundation’s efforts span 6,769 villages across 19 states, enriching the lives of 9.1 million people. We implement our CSR initiatives through the Adani Foundation who oversees project site activities, while our in-house team manages O&M stage projects.

Project Kamdhenu for Livestock Development in Rajasthan and Gujarat
Adani Foundation’s flagship initiative, Project Kamdhenu, aims at improving livestock productivity, enhancing cattle breed & productivity and strengthening farmers' knowledge in the Jaisalmer, Khavda and Dayapar regions of Rajasthan and Gujarat states. The project aims to elevate the economic conditions of livestock owners through capacity building, livestock and cattle breed improvement through artificial insemination, and better access to cattle healthcare & nutrition services.

Climate Action Through Water Conservation
The Jaisalmer and Barmer districts of Rajasthan, along with Khavda and Dayapar in the Kutch District of Gujarat experience severe water scarcity due to harsh climatic conditions. Through the Adani Foundation, we have implemented several water conservation activities, including pond rejuvenation through deepening & cleaning, expanding water catchment area, check dam maintenance, construction of filtration wells, installation of RO plants in schools, and building overhead potable water tanks. These initiatives focus on enhancing water storage capacity, recharging groundwater, and strengthening community resilience against water scarcity.

Project Utthan – Improving Education in Khavda, Gujarat
Through Adani Foundation’s flagship educational initiative, Project Utthan, we support 8 government high schools in the Khavda, Gujarat, by empowering Utthan Sahayaks (Supplement Teachers) to enhance student learning outcomes in Maths, Science, and English. Additionally, Community Mobilisers engaged with parents to encourage prioritising their children's education, particularly for girls. The project also includes initiatives such as Road Safety Week, self-defence training for girls and the ‘Eye Vison Care’ programme for students’ eye health.

Breaking Barriers: Empowering Girls’ Education in Khavda
In remote areas like Khavda in Kutch, access to education remains a challenge for girls. With female literacy rates below 40% and only 16.2% of girls enrolling in high school, safety concerns often force them to abandon their academic aspirations. One such student, Sohana Inush Chaki, a determined 12th grader, faced an uncertain future as the lack of a local examination centre meant travelling long distances under unsafe conditions.
Adani Foundation’s Intervention
Recognising the issue, the Adani Foundation collaborated with the community and village council to establish an examination centre in Khavda. This intervention removed a major barrier to education, ensuring that girls like Sohana could pursue their studies without compromising their safety. With newfound hope and determination, Sohana appeared for her Class 12 exams locally, securing an impressive 76.71%, paving the way for a promising future.
